  2. One of my childhood soccer heroes, Fernando Ricksen, wrote a biography about his mad life of soccer, drugs, booze, hookers, and fucking famous women. He started for my local team Fortuna Sittard, then played for AZ Alkmaar, Glasgow Rangers, Zenit St. Petersburg and after winning the UEFA Cup with Zenit he quit soccer to detox from drinking. He eventually came back on an amateur contract to save Fortuna from relegation to the amateur leagues and succeeded.

     

    He was on a Dutch talkshow to promote his book, but instead of that, he announced he has ALS (Lou Gehrig's Disease) and will likely die within just a few years.

  10. Do any phones allow you to text a location? That would be neat

     

    You can do that through the popular unlimited texting app Whatsapp. It connects to Google Maps and your GPS and you can send your location to a single person or in a group chat. I use the app daily for both business and personal, as it allows anyone with an internet connection on a phone to text with extremely low data usages. I use it for thousands of messages a month and just the texts are under 50kb. It's pretty awesome.

     

    It works with any number, anywhere in the world and to all mobile OS platforms. I have Android, Grace has an iPhone and one of my managers a Blackberry and that's no issue.
